- the present invention relates to a centrifuge for use in spraying liquid material intended to converted into so-called prills.
- This process so-called prilling," consists in liquid material, which for instance can be molten material or a concentrated solution and in which solid particles may be dispersed being ejected through the perforated wall of a centrifuge. In this way the sprayed material is divided into droplets which can be caused to solidify by falling through a gas or a liquid.
- Prilling is especially used for concentrated molten fertilizers with low water content comprising amongst others suspensions containing the plane nutrients N and P, in which may also be suspended or dispersed solid materials such as potassium salts, magnesium salts and micronutrients.
- the present invention now relates to a centrifuge for use in prilling liquid material, for example concentrated molten fertilizers with a low water content as above mentioned, in which centrifuge the above mentioned problems are eliminated or at least reduced to a substantial degree.
- a centrifuge according to the invention is substantially characterized by a displacement body arranged in the centrifuge container, the surface of said body facing the perforated wall of the centrifuge container having substantially the same rotational shape as the wall of the centrifuge container and being concentric with the same.
- the distance between the centrifuge wall and the displacement body should preferably not be more than 20 mm. and can preferably be from 2 l mm.
- the displacement body is stationary, but it is also possible to mount it on a shaft which is rotatable independently of the centrifuge container.
- the liquid material to be prilled can be supplied to the annular space between the perforated centrifuge wall and the displacement body at the upper or lower end of the same. It is, however, also possible to supply the liquid material to the interior of a hollow displacement body and to let the material flow out through orifices in the wall of the displacement body.

- numeral 1 designates a centrifuge container which can be of a performance known per se.
- the centrifuge container is attached to a shaft 2, which can be set in rotation at a suitable speed, for instance 500 to 1500 rev./min.
- the conical wall la of the centrifuge container is perforated in usual manner.
- the perforations are not shown in the draw- Three designates a displacement body which according to the invention is arranged in the interior of the centrifuge container.
- the side of the displacement body facing the perforated wall of the centrifuge container is provided with a surface which is substantially concentric with the perforated wall of the centrifuge container.
- the displacement body 3 is attached to a tube-shaped body 4 surrounding the centrifuge shaft 2.
- 5 designates orifices in the wall of the tube 4 just above the displacement body. Below these orifices, the inner side of the tube is provided with guide bafflcs 6 (for instance lips") serving to guide a part of the liquid material out through the orifices 5.
- Liquid material to be prilled is supplied to the centrifuge container through the annular intermediate space 7 between tube 4 and shaft 2.
- the tube 4 is open at the lower end so that the liquid material will flow out into the centrifuge container at the bottom of the same and then flow upwardly through the annular intermediate space between the perforated wall Ia of the centrifuge container and the displacement body 3.
- Part of the liquid material will as above mentioned flow out through the orifices 5 and then flow outwards and downwards to the upper end of the annular spacebetween the wall la and the displacement body 3.
- the orifices 5 may be omitted if desired.
- FIG. 2 deviates from the embodiment according to FIG. 1 mainly in that the liquid materi' al is supplied to the inside of a hollow displacement body. ln this FIG. 1. la and 2 designate corresponding parts to those in H6. 1.
- 3a is a displacement body, which in H0. 2 is made hollow.
- the wall 3!; facing the perforated wall la of the centrifuge container is provided with orifices or slots 3c.
- the displacement body is attached to a tube 4a surrounding the centrifuge shaft 2.
- the tube 40 can be stationary or may be rotatably mounted independently of the shaft 2.
- the displacement body 3a is provided with a cylindrical wall 8 surrounding the tube 4a at some distance from the same.
- the liquid material is supplied to the centrifuge through the annular intermediate space 9 between the tube 4a and the wall 8.
- the liquid material flows through this intermediate space down to the hollow displacement body and flows out through the orifices 3c to the intermediate space between the displacement body and the perforated wall la of the centrifuge container.
